The Hague — 9 nights

Judicial Capital of the World
Known as the "judicial capital of the world," The Hague is the center for everything official in the Netherlands: the home of the Dutch government and parliament, the workplace of the King and Queen, and the base of many international affairs such as the International Court of Justice and the International Criminal Court.Get a sense of the local culture at The Mauritshuis Royal Picture Gallery and museum Beelden aan Zee. Venture out of the city with trips to Rotterdam (The Red Apple, Erasmus Bridge, &more). There's still lots to do: try out the rides at Madurodam, make a trip to Panorama Mesdag, examine the collection at Louwman Museum The Hague, and ponder the world of politics at Binnenhof & Ridderzaal (Inner Court & Hall of the Knights).
